Horrible Sales Culture

Recommend
CEO approval
Business Outlook

Pros

Remote work. That’s about it.

Cons

The sales organization is extremely unorganized and toxic. AE’s and BDR’s are constantly pressured to hit unachiveable targets and are guilt tripped into working overtime to try and hit their numbers. 80% of the sales organization is not even close to hitting quotas. Instead of management trying to fix quota, they just increase quota and hire/fire employees whenever they want. Onboarding was also pretty rough. Whenever you ask a question, you’re pointed towards “Guru”. Managers themselves don’t know the answers to your questions. You’re basically just thrown into the fire with no tools to support you. AE’s are expected to prospect but don’t even have access to Zoominfo lol. Account lists change every month and they are not at all fair. Do not work here. It is not worth your mental health at all. Extremely shady company- the worst I’ve ever worked at.

Pros

Good benefits Nice team Growing Market Fit

Cons

VC and investor pressure is at a high, leading to a severe drop in team morale. Management is overwhelming employees, evident from consistently declining engagement survey ratings. 1Password culture has taken a nose dive as of late. Decisions are being made impulsively without data to back it up and teams are being stretched extremely thin. Sales and Customer Success Managers clash due to conflicting goals. Sales faces no consequences for selling to unfit customers, while success lacks motivation to assist with expansions. I do not blame sales they have high targets which are difficult to meet with 1 product skew.
